摘要
A new method is presented for mesoscopic simulations of particle dispersions in liquid crystal solvents. It allows efficient first principle simulations of the dispersions involving many particles with many body interactions mediated by the solvents. Demonstrations have been performed for the aggregation of colloid dispersions in two dimensional nematic and smectic-C* solvents neglecting hydrodynamic effects, which will be taken into account in the near future.
